Are those 2 site new or old? Domain age are more than 6 months?

I've been doing SEO for one of my sites (2 months old) and I've came to learn something:

I keep tracking my site ranking everyday or every couple of days. I noticed that when I build back links to my website, the ranking drop down for a couple of days then after few days it comes back either as same as before or even better. This is known as: Google Dance. Example: Yesterday Rank : page 4, Today's Rank: page 12-30

this usually happens when you start building back links to your web pages. I used to panic when I see my ranking drop but now I understand that when my ranking drops then it means that Google started to see my backlinks and is re-evaluating my ranking. I believe that it's ok as long as you site still appear on search engine results.

Another thing is that if you have new site, you might get very good ranking at the beginning for the first few weeks of launching your website then your site drop back in ranking and stays there. If this the case then it's time to start SEO for your website.

Try to stop any SEO you're doing right now for about 7-10 days and monitor your site ranking. If it goes back to the previous rank or better then it's Google Dance, continue your SEO (you're doing good job).

Now, get used to Google Dance and don't panic :D Welcome to SEO

You have to do both, increase your website authority by increasing the size of your website through adding unique content frequently and then keep building quality back links to your web pages.

Usually most people fail with SEO cause they think it's magic while it need hard work and long time to see results. You should expect to get results some where between 6 months to one years. You have to be patient.

Google is looking at websites in a little different way now. They are trying to make it more user friendly. Content of your website must be one of the first things, a visitor sees at your site. ex.

If a customer searches for a portraitphotographer and reaches your site. Content must apply to the initial search keywords, within first display frame. It should not be placed so that the visitor must scroll. Huge ads in header is also a no go now. A Wordpress blog is in a little trouble because of the big header images, and therefor the need to be thoroughly ALT tagged, to try to come around this issue.

grbrain in this time please check wich reasone is active on your sites:
in google webmaster google added you a message about google pnalty.
2-if you tryed to make spam page automatically made page for each tag.
3-if contents are same as old site therefor your site is mirror of it.
4-increase 404 errors that you can found if it is true in google webmaster > crawl errors.
5-check robots.txt maybe disallowed all pages. test with google fetch as google webmaster tools.
6-check header status with live header extension of firefox
7-check tag html robots maybe hacker changed it or joomla made it to noindex
8-you clicked more than normal case on your link in google results.
9-meta tag html refresh page or redirect to other page or openning popup.
10-you shown different content to robots with normal users. some programmers use header or function to determind robots with others to made different content to better seo content but google see it as spam or pnalty.
